What is it called if a substance is formed by the neutralization of acid and alkali?

Chemistry
2 answers:
AleksandrR [38]3 years ago
6 0

Explanation:

Salt is a substance which is found by the neutralization of acid and alkali..

How many molecules are contained in 1.55 moles of methane, CH 4 ?
Korolek [52]

Avogadro's law states that in one mole of a substance, there are 6.022 \times 10^{23} molecules.

This means that in 1.55 moles, there are 1.55(6.022 \times 10^{23})=\boxed{9.33 \times 10^{23} \text{( to 3 sf)}}
